I'm not sure how many people have been following or are aware of this, but there has been quite a battle for the Christmas number 1 music single in the UK which was decided this evening. The two singles battling it out were the usual one from the XFactor winner (Joe McSomething) and... erm... Killing in the name by Rage Against The Machine...
It has become somewhat of a tradition for the winner of XFactor to get Christmas number 1, so a few people on FaceBook (700,000 or so) thought they should buy something else instead as some sort of protest against Simon Cowell / XFactor. And it worked! Its all a bit of a shock, and a few records were set along the way including being the first UK number 1 by downloads alone. Being not the biggest fan of XFactor, I think it's quite brilliant, although quite a dodgy and ironic choice of song, but RATM are donating over £70,000 to charity from it which has to be a good thing.
